Conjugation

The verb "have" in Iranian Persian is conjugated as follows:

Person Singular Plural
I دارم (dāram) داریم (dārim)
You داری (dāri) دارید (dārid)
He/She/It دارد (dārad) دارند (dārand)

Usage

The verb "have" is used in a variety of ways in Iranian Persian. It can be used to express possession, ownership, or to indicate that something is happening.

Possession

The verb "have" is used to express possession or ownership. For example:

  • من یک پسر دارم (man yek pasar dāram) - I have a son.
  • او یک خودرو دارد (u yek khodro dārad) - He has a car.

Happening

The verb "have" is also used to indicate that something is happening. For example:

  • من یک روز خوب دارم (man yek roz khob dāram) - I am having a good day.
  • او یک مشکل دارد (u yek moshkel dārad) - He is having a problem.

Examples

Here are some examples of sentences using the verb "have":

Person Iranian Persian Pronunciation English Translation
I من یک خودرو دارم man yek khodro dāram I have a car.
You تو یک بچه داری to yek bache dāri You have a child.
He/She/It او یک خانواده دارد u yek khanvade dārad He has a family.
